At the 2023 Consumer Electronics Show in Las Vegas, Ram unveiled their close-to-production concept of the upcoming 1500 Revolution model. This show truck is a visual departure from prior trucks but still keeps several iconic features that will be instantly recognizable to viewers. It provides an exciting glimpse into how this renowned truck manufacturer intends to bring its design into the future.
The signature daytime running lights of the front fascia split the light clusters, with a glowing 3D Ram badge that stands out. With an overall rugged aesthetic and shorter front than today’s ICE Ram 1500 for improved passenger compartment size, you can expect more spaciousness in this truck.
From the side, the 1500 Revolution BEV has a sleek design for a truck. Its A-pillar slants back giving it an elegant look that stands out from other trucks in its class – even more so than the Rivian R1T! The manufacturer of the electric 1500 concept forecasts an exciting future with Level 3+ self driving capability, exterior projectors to provide a unique movie theater experience and also communicate important information to passengers, as well as Shadow Mode that allows the vehicle to follow hikers on off-road trails. This cutting edge technology will revolutionize how we explore our world.
The concept truck is based on Stellantis’ STLA Frame architecture and contains a potent dual-motor system that produces all-wheel drive. While the manufacturer has not specified the power output of this setup, an earlier report suggested it could be as powerful as 885 horsepower – enough to make it lightning quick.
